Text #467 (Length: 297 characters)

The theory of music emphasizes the elements from which music is composed. One such structure is the melody, which is a grouping of musical notes that combine into a basic, but immensely flexible structure. Another is the chord, which is two or more notes played simultaneously to create a harmony.
